## Authentication — Spokeshift Rebalancer

The rebalancer pulls dock occupancy from the Fleetgrid internal API every two minutes. Auth is a static key passed in the `X-Fleetgrid-Key` header; no OAuth, no refresh flow. If requests return 401, the key was rotated — check the #spokeshift-ops channel before paging anyone. On-call: do not restart the scheduler without confirming auth first, or trucks get dispatched on stale data. For emergency manual runs against staging, use the key below.

API key for yahig-tadup: kto7_ubizbYm

Changed defaults in Splitfork, our assignment service. Bucketing now uses sticky hashing per account instead of per session, and the holdout slice grew from 2% to 5%. Callers relying on session-level reassignment must opt in explicitly. Review the diff against the new baseline; the updated default configuration is listed below.

config for tagep-kajof:
[casir]
port = 6379
region = south-1
host = casir.paliqdyn.example
team = tamax
timeout_ms = 250
retries = 2

### RestockPilot: Release Prerequisites

Before cutting a release, confirm that the RestockPilot planner can reach the SnackGrid inventory service, since the build pipeline runs an integration smoke test against staging during packaging. A failed handshake here blocks the release tag, so verify credentials first. The pipeline reads its staging credential from the deploy config; for reference and manual verification, the current key appears below.

service key, tajof-fawip: vxb4-JNOz

## v3.4.1 — Sweeper tune-up

Heads up, new folks: the Ashgrove data-retention sweeper got a decent overhaul this release. It now batches deletions in smaller chunks so the nightly run doesn't hog the primary, skips records flagged under legal hold (finally), and logs a summary you can actually read. Dry-run mode is on by default in staging, so don't panic if nothing disappears. Questions, weird edge cases, or restore requests go to the person named below.

account owner for bawip-tahag: Raleth Quenok